Apiary-backed Roar B2B acquires Environment Media Group

Apiary-backed Roar B2B, the events and media group, is pleased to announce it has acquired Environment Media Group (EMG), the UK’s leading specialist media and events business focused on the waste management and recycling sector. The acquisition of EMG combines Roar’s Recycling and Waste Management (RWM) trade show, with LetsRecycle, establishing Roar as the UK’s leading media partner in the environmental sector.

Through its website, www.letsrecycle.com, EMG provides topical news reports, legislative updates and a range of events for businesses, local authorities and community groups involved in recycling and waste management. Rob Mowat, who has led the company for 20 years, will be staying with the business and will head up Roar’s environmental media portfolio.
